F280049PZS Description
The TMS320F28004x (F28004x) is a powerful 32-bit floating-point microcontroller unit (MCU) that allows designers to integrate critical control peripherals, differential analog and non-volatile memory on a single device. The real-time control subsystem is based on TI's 32-bit C28x processor and provides 100 MHz signal processing performance. The new TMU extension instruction set and the VCU-I extension instruction set further improve the performance of C28x CPU. The TMU extension instruction set supports fast execution algorithms using trigonometric operations commonly used in transform and torque loop calculations, while the VCU-I extension instruction set reduces the latency of complex mathematical operations common in coding applications. CLA allows you to significantly uninstall common tasks from the master c28x CPU. CLA is an independent 32-bit floating-point mathematical accelerator that executes in parallel with CPU. In addition, CLA has its own dedicated memory resources, which can directly access the key peripherals needed by a typical control system. Support for ANSIC subsets is standard, as are key functions such as hardware breakpoints and hardware task switching. F28004x supports flash memory up to 256KB (128KW) and is divided into two 128KB (64KW) groups for parallel programming and execution. 4Kb (2KW) and 16Kb (8KW) blocks also provide on-chip SRAM up to 100Kb (50KW) for efficient system partitioning. Flash ECC, SRAM ECC/ parity and dual zone security are also supported.
F280049PZS Features
? TMS320C28x 32-bit CPU
– 100 MHz
– IEEE 754 single-precision Floating-Point Unit
(FPU)
– Trigonometric Math Unit (TMU)
? 3×-cycle to 4×-cycle improvement for
common trigonometric functions versus
software libraries
? 13-cycle Park transform
– Viterbi/Complex Math Unit (VCU-I)
– Ten hardware breakpoints (with ERAD)
? Programmable Control Law Accelerator (CLA)
– 100 MHz
– IEEE 754 single-precision floating-point
instructions
– Executes code independently of main CPU
? On-chip memory
– 256KB (128KW) of flash (ECC-protected)
across two independent banks
– 100KB (50KW) of RAM (ECC-protected or
parity-protected)
– Dual-zone security supporting third-party
development
– Unique Identification (UID) number
? Clock and system control
– Two internal zero-pin 10-MHz oscillators
– On-chip crystal oscillator and external clock
input
– Windowed watchdog timer module
– Missing clock detection circuitry
? 1.2-V core, 3.3-V I/O design
– Internal VREG or DC-DC for 1.2-V generation
allows for single-supply designs
– Brownout reset (BOR) circuit
? System peripherals
– 6-channel Direct Memory Access (DMA)
controller
– 40 individually programmable multiplexed
General-Purpose Input/Output (GPIO) pins
– 21 digital inputs on analog pins
– Enhanced Peripheral Interrupt Expansion
(ePIE) module
– Multiple low-power mode (LPM) support with
external wakeup
F280049PZS Applications
? Medium/short range radar
? Air conditioner outdoor unit
? Door operator drive control
? Automated sorting equipment
? CNC control
? Textile machine
? Welding machine
? AC charging (pile) station
? DC charging (pile) station
? EV charging station power module
? Wireless vehicle charging module
? Energy storage power conversion system (PCS)
? Central inverter
? Solar power optimizer
? String inverter
? DC/DC converter
? Inverter & motor control
? On-board (OBC) & wireless charger
? AC drive control module
? AC drive power stage module
? Linear motor power stage
? Servo drive control module
? AC-input BLDC motor drive
? DC-input BLDC motor drive
? Industrial AC-DC
? Three phase UPS
? Merchant network & server PSU
? Merchant telecom rectifiers